It’s gonna blow on Toulouse ! This Monday, September 5, 2022, the town hall announces the closure of parks and gardens reported at risk. The reason ? A weather alert warning of gusts of wind greater than 60 km/h and 80 km/h.
The parks and gardens concerned
Here is the list of the different places affected by this closure:
- Compans Caffarelli Garden
- Grand Rond Garden
- Garden of the Pays d’Oc
- Garden of plants
- Royal Garden
- Gunpowder Garden (Empalot – Ramier)
- Reynerie Park
- Monlong Park
- Ozenne Park (Bordrouge)
- Félix Lavit Garden (Rose Garden)
- Garden Villa Mérican (Rose garden)
- Observatory Park (Rose Garden)
- Boisseraie Park (The Terrace)
- Sacarin Garden (The Terrace)
- Saint-Exupéry Garden (The Terrace)
- Sacred Heart Park (Rangueil Pech David)
- Rangueil garden
